At Philippine peso (PhP) 2.50–5.30 (USD0.05–0.10) per kilowatt-hour (kWh) excluding financing costs, rooftop solar can deliver lower-cost energy than conventional coal-fired power plants and unlock as much as PhP1.5 trillion (US$2.8 billion) in new investment by 2030, according to a 2019 study from the Institute for Energy Economics and Financial Analysis (IEEFA). In 2008, the Philippines government passed a renewable energy law with goals of doubling renewable power capacity by 2030 and reducing the nation’s dependence on coal-fired power in order to achieve energy independence, enhance energy access, reliability and resilience, lower energy costs, boost all islands’ economies and improve lives, livelihoods and the environment. Philippine President Rodrigo Duterte and predecessors have set some ambitious national and international renewable energy, greenhouse gas (GHG) emissions reduction and sustainable development goals, including achieving universal electrification by 2022. Coal-fired power generation, by comparison, costs upwards of PhP3.80–5.50 (USD0.074–0.11) per kWh, and the true cost of imported diesel-fired power ranges from PhP15–PhP28 per kWh, according to IEEFA. The average solar radiation ranges from 128 - 203 W/m2 which is equivalent to around 4.5 - 5.5 kWh/m2/day. Non-exclusive though it is, Solar Para sa Bayan’s franchise stifles market competition and innovation in the Philippines’ nascent distributed solar-storage and microgrid market , one that encompasses some 4.5 million-plus households, around 15 million people, across the Philippines. Electricity costs in the Philippines are the highest among the Association of Southeast Asian Nations’ (ASEAN) 10 member countries at around 10 PhP/kWh (USD0.20/kWh). Key Highlights.
